Taking the bus to go skiing

Parking at the Park City local areas has become very difficult and frustrating if one doesn’t decide to leave early in the morning to go Skiing. Then, by leaving before the masses, there’s plenty of waiting time inside the car or at the nearby coffee shop until lines begin forming around the base ski lifts. 

All this amounts to a royal waste of time no one wants, particularly on weekends. This new reality has prompted me to ride our local Shuttle more frequently this season. To start, I don’t want to risk an accident with my car as I circle forever around the gigantic parking lot to locate an empty spot left by a departing automobile, not to mention the risk of hitting one of the many pot-holes that pop up everyday on that large expanse of asphalt. Right, that’s both added risk and time wasted!

The shuttle bus isn’t a convenient option either where my house is located, but I can make it work and by texting the passage time of the next shuttle at a given spot, I can get a good estimated time of pick-up and work my departure from home accordingly. 

Returning isn’t as simple as time riding the lift, more so than the duration of descent, affects the return to the bus-stop for the travel home. In addition, after all that skiing, who wants to wait 10, 20 or even more minutes? This is even truer as the day wears on, shuttle schedules slip and traffic congestion creeps up. 

What can I say? I guess: “Shut up and enjoy the ride!”
